Problem: Difficulty connecting chemical theory with real-world examples

Chemistry can seem detached from daily life for students at James Ruse Agricultural High School or Sydney Girls High School. They may memorize formulas but fail to see how reactions appear beyond the page. This gap often leads to frustration and loss of interest.

Solution: Tutors simplify theory by using relatable examples. Combustion is explained through the city’s transport systems, while concepts of corrosion and redox reactions are connected to the maintenance of the Sydney Harbour Bridge. When students recognize how equations apply to familiar places, chemistry becomes more engaging and relevant.

Problem: Losing confidence after low test scores

Even capable students at Fort Street High School or St Andrew’s Cathedral School struggle when results don’t match their effort. Poor grades can quickly erode motivation.

Solution: Tutors focus on rebuilding confidence through structured practice and steady progress tracking. Weekly quizzes modeled on New South Wales Education Standards Authority (NESA) papers help identify areas of weakness early. Each small success reinforces improvement and strengthens belief in their ability to learn.

Problem: Struggling with visualizing molecular concepts

Molecules and bonds are invisible to the eye, making it difficult for many learners to grasp complex topics such as chemical equilibrium or molecular geometry.
Solution: Tutors use visual aids, animations, and simple analogies to make abstract topics visible. Lessons might reference interactive science exhibits at the Powerhouse Museum or environmental experiments around Sydney Harbour to illustrate reaction processes. Seeing chemistry in action helps students connect mental models to real phenomena.

Problem: Managing time during high-pressure exams

Chemistry exams test both understanding and precision. Students from Randwick Girls High School or Knox Grammar often spend too long explaining one part of a question, leaving others incomplete.

Solution: Tutors teach time management through mock exams that simulate real test conditions. By learning how to divide marks per minute and handle longer responses effectively, students turn pressure into control. This structured preparation builds composure during actual assessments.

Problem: Overreliance on memorization

Many students believe success in chemistry depends on memorizing reactions, forgetting that understanding mechanisms is far more valuable.

Solution: Tutors emphasize reasoning over recall. Instead of listing acids and bases, learners explore how neutralization appears in the city’s water treatment facilities or pH testing conducted in Sydney’s coastal labs. Practical association turns theory into logic, helping students retain knowledge naturally.
